The word Waltham has 2 syllables: waltham. Syllable division helps in understanding the word's structure, improving both pronunciation and spelling. This technique is especially useful for students and language learners who are mastering English phonetics.
Waltham is a city in Massachusetts, United States.

The word 'waltham' has 2 syllables. The first syllable is 'wal' and the second syllable is 'tham'. The vowels in this word are 'a' and 'a', and the consonants are 'w', 'l', 't', 'h', 'm'.
